We’re excited to share some fantastic news! Thanks to regular monitoring and our commitment to maintaining safe water conditions, several local swimming spots have been declared safe for swimming.


Meander River (Eggmont Reserve, Birralee Road, Westbury)
Liffey River (Bracknell River Reserve, Louisa Street, Bracknell)
South Esk River (Hadspen Lions Park, Main Street, Hadspen)

Recent testing shows bacteria levels at these locations have dropped below guideline limits, meaning it’s a great time to enjoy our beautiful rivers safely.

Lake Trevallyn (Blackstone Park, Blackstone Park Drive, Blackstone Heights) remains unsuitable for swimming as bacteria levels are still above safe limits. Recreational swimming is not recommended, and anyone choosing to swim does so at their own risk. Testing and monitoring will continue early this week, and we’ll provide updates as soon as conditions improve at Lake Trevallyn.
